Answer:
9 rolls
Step-by-step explanation:
The perimeter of the room measures 2(19' +12') = 62', so the area of the walls is ...
(62 ft)(8.5 ft) = 527 ft²
We know that 8 rolls will cover 8×60 ft² = 480 ft², and 9 rolls will cover 540 ft², so we will need 9 rolls to cover the walls.
Answer: 1,612 eggs
Step-by-step explanation:
Alex has a total of 806 dinosaurs. He also has twice as many eggs as he does dinosaurs.
The number of eggs is therefore:
= Number of dinosaurs * 2
= 806 * 2
= 1,612 eggs
